Amazon (AWS) Solution Architect Interview Process Guide

Landing any job at Amazon is not easy, let alone a Solution Architect position. This page will walk you through everything you need to know about the process and the position so that you can come as prepared as possible.

You will learn:

  • What the interviewers are looking for.
  • How to prepare for the different rounds.
  • Your Roles and Responsibilities.
  • Things you can expect during the interview process.
  • Amazon Interview questions, basic knowledge.

Whether you are just starting in AWS or an experienced professional, this guide will give you the information and confidence you need to pass your interview, assessment test and land your dream job.

To learn more, read on!

Untitled design

What Does a Solution Architect Do at Amazon?

AWS Solutions Architects design and build business applications and critical infrastructure within AWS Cloud.

They have the skills and expertise to migrate, design, and build cloud-based solutions to existing workloads.

A solution architect is an ideal opportunity for anyone interested in cloud computing. AWS has much to offer and can make a huge difference in technology. AWS Solutions Architects assist clients in using cloud technology effectively.

AWS Solution Architect Roles and Responsibilities

Meetings with Sales and Customers

As an AWS Solutions Architect, your job will be to design solutions. Customers and sales will make up a large portion of your workday.

These meetings could be held in person or via conference calls. It all depends on your company and what role you play within it.

AWS Solution Architects might be more focused on products than customers. Some of their tasks are to solve customer problems. Others do not.

Problem Solving

Your main task will be to design solutions that meet customer goals and needs. As a pre-sales representative, you will also be responsible for developing technical solutions and supporting customer goals.

Your day will include some complex problem-solving. You will create solutions plans and help customers understand AWS architecture best practices. You’ll estimate the cost, identify cost control mechanisms and choose the best AWS service for your data, compute, and security needs.


All of the above may make it seem like your days are predictable. But they won’t because an AWS Solutions Architect’s typical day involves many tasks. Your day might be spent reviewing existing environments and planning new ones.

Depending on your role and where you work, you might be traveling to customer meetings. You could write scripts, manage migrations, troubleshoot, or keep up to date with AWS’s new features. You will likely work with other departments, such as sales, engineers, and even the engineering department.

Time Management

You’ll need to be able to manage all the tasks that come up in your day. As an AWS Solutions Architect, you will likely need to plan your day, manage your time on tasks, and prioritize your projects.

Keep Current

AWS is constantly evolving, just as with every technology. AWS is constantly evolving, so you could spend part of your day learning about new services and features or keeping up with the best practices for improving existing AWS solutions. You can also find updates and best practices on blogs and discussion boards. You might also find other SAs discussing solutions. You might need to know more if you are an AWS Solution Architect.

What Are the Requirements for Becoming an AWS Solution Architect?

Educational qualifications, Experiences, and Skills recruiters at Amazon look for when hiring Solutions Architects are:

Education and Experience

  • A bachelor’s degree is required in Computer Science, Mathematics, or Engineering.
  • 8+ years of experience in specific technology domains, such as Software Development, Systems Engineering, Cloud Computing, Infrastructure, Networking, Security, Data, and Analytics.
  • Experience designing, implementing, and consulting applications and infrastructures for 3+ years.
  • Communication skills with non-technical and technical audiences, executive-level stakeholders, and clients.
  • Experience in enterprise IT applications for 7+ years
  • 2+ years experience in software development, systems administration, DevOps engineering, network administration, systems architecture, IT security, and other technical disciplines.
  • Knowledge of software development tools, software engineering principles, methodologies, and techniques.


These are the key skills required to be a Solutions Architect:

  • Programming languages such as Java, Python or C# are used for scripting and programming.
  • Data storage.
  • Networking.
  • Information Retrieval.
  • Distributed Computing.
  • Large-Scale System Design.
  • Patterns and technologies specific to the cloud.
  • AWS Service Selection.
  • System Security.
  • Operating Systems like Linux, Solaris, and Windows.

AWS Certified Solutions Architect – Associate certification is required by some companies. Certifications not only add value to your resume as an AWS Solution Architect but also increase your chances of being hired.

What To Expect in the Amazon AWS Interview Process?

Amazon’s interview process is often exhausting. The good news is that the process is fairly predictable. Knowing the structure of the interview before the interview makes preparations much easier and reduces the chance of surprises. This doesn’t necessarily mean that the interview will be easy. It does not mean you’ll be blind, however.

This guide will provide information on what to expect from a solutions architect interview. It includes questions about technical expertise, cloud computing principles, concepts, behavioral queries, processes, risk management, presentation skills, and technical knowledge. Interviews can be conducted via both phone screen and on-site interviews.

How Do I Prepare For the AWS Solutions Architect Interview Process?

A strong understanding of all levels of the AWS solution architects’ interview process is important to prepare efficiently. Each stage of the solution architect process is designed to measure success on every parameter possible.

The AWS Solutions Architect hiring process is comprised of the following steps:

Resume and Online Application

Finding the right job is the first step. You can search AWS careers by keyword, location, job category, or keyword.

Click “Apply now” to apply for the role that interests you. If you have already applied, you will be asked to create or log in to a new profile.

The online instructions will guide you through the remainder of your application.

AWS Online Assessment

Online assessments measure the key attributes required to succeed in a job. Online assessments allow amazon to evaluate applicants consistently and equitably since everyone receives the same experience as the information needed for the assessment.

You may be asked for an assessment depending on your position. The number of assessments you must complete will vary depending on the job. After the initial application stage, you will be given an Amazon online assessment test to assess your AWS role. It includes a work simulation test, technical questions, and personality tests.

We are now going to break down each segment of the assessment, which will culminate in a phone interview providing that you pass the assessment itself.

Work Style Assessment

These interview questions focus on Amazon’s unique culture and Leadership Principles. They may ask you to select which statement best describes your work style as a solutions architect. For example, “I like things to be well-structured” or “I enjoy learning new things.” These assessments usually take between 10-20 minutes.

Here is an example:

work-style-assessment ranking question

Work Sample Simulation

Virtual tasks will be required to fulfill the job description. You may be asked to complete virtual tasks related to the position you are applying for.

You may be asked to answer customer questions, interpret data, find the correct information from multiple sources, or help customers. These tasks typically take between 20 and 60 minutes.

Technical Knowledge Test

This Amazon Web Services Assessment section requires the most professional experience of all four.

This test will present you with 24 multiple-choice questions. These questions will assess your technical knowledge of servers and connectivity.

Technical Skills Survey

After passing the technical knowledge test, you can tell Amazon your strengths and weaknesses.

You will be asked to rate your proficiency with Big Data and Linux on a scale of “No Experience” up to “Expert”.

In this section, it is best to tell the truth about where you are at and your strengths. Remember, Amazon doesn’t expect you and other candidates to be experts in all subjects.

However, this doesn’t mean that you should not prepare ahead. This section is the same as the previous section. You can only benefit from studying technical concepts and brushing up before taking this assessment. Be prepared to be pushed to your very limits.

This will allow Amazon and you to see where you are in the AWS world.

Working with Customers Simulation

This section is 15 minutes long and includes scenario-based questions. These questions are sent in an email from your Team Lead, AWS customers, and co-workers. You’ll be asked to rate each response differently by choosing the right system for each scenario.

Phone Interview

These conversations will discuss your experiences, including past situations and challenges and how you dealt with them. Focus on the question, ensure your answer is structured, and provide data or metrics if necessary. When possible, refer to recent situations.

Amazon avoids brain teaser questions during interviews because they don’t believe they can predict a candidate’s success in AWS. They instead ask behavior-based questions about your work experience and style.

On-Site Interview

Before your interview, thinking about your successes and failures with the Amazon Leadership Principles is crucial. Then plan how to talk about them using STAR.

Give examples of your expertise demonstrating your knowledge and how you have taken risks, succeeded, failed, and learned from them.

Failure is part of innovation. Some of the most successful programs were rooted in failed projects. It is important to learn from each effort.

Amazon Solution Architect Interview Questions

These domains will be used for both online and on-site interviews for the amazon solution architect interview process.

Questions about background and experience

Your background and experience will guide the first few questions you ask on-site or online. For the role of a solutions architect, you will need two years of experience in system design, management, and debugging using AWS Cloud.

Questions on Key Skills

Here you are being tested on technical concepts like EBS, autoscaling, and Amazon VPC launches. Data connections, deep understanding of system design principles, Amazon S3, AMI, and differences between Dynamodb and Redshift.

Processors, networking concepts and Elastic Beanstalk. System design, CloudFront Geo Restrictions, AWS Lambda, Amazon ElastiCach. Types of cloud services. Sharding, encryptions.

Preparation Tips for the Amazon Solution Architect Interviews

  • Interview questions for solution architects will likely include questions that describe, explain and distinguish situations.
  • Asking scenarios-based questions is a good idea if you are looking for AWS interview questions and responses for experienced software architects.
  • Create a STAR Method for all your major experiences. Using the STAR technique to answer, you will describe the situation, the given task, the action you took, and assess the result of your actions on the topic.
  • Base your answers on Amazon’s Leadership Principles (see the chart below.)
Amazon 16 Leadership Principles.

Amazon Solution Architect Salaries

Solutions Architecture’s compensation packages are quite competitive compared to other companies.

The average salary for different levels:

  • L4 138,000.
  • L5 203,000.
  • L6 276,000.
  • L7 368,000.

Career Path

AWS Solutions Architects’ career path depends on their work experience and the type of projects they are working on. AWS Solution Architects come from many backgrounds and can take on a range of roles at various points in their careers in the organization with various teams.

This Is How a Typical AWS Solutions Architect Would Look

Bachelor’s Degree in Computer Science – Master’s Degree in Systems Architecture (some employers need MBAs and other certifications) – 3+ Years experience working with IT systems and proficiency in one or two programming languages.